State, Regional & Local Taxes

🇰🇿 KazakhstanRegional & Local Taxes

Kazakhstan's 14 regions (oblasy), 3 cities of republican significance (Almaty, Astana, Shymkent), and 1 special zone have some tax administration responsibilities. The Ministry of Finance sets all tax rates nationally. Local governments collect property tax on individuals (0.1%–1% of value), vehicle tax, and land tax. The Astana International Financial Centre (AIFC) operates as a special English law jurisdiction with 0% income and corporate tax until 2066 for qualifying participants. Kazakhstan has been modernizing its tax system under OECD guidelines.

🇧🇷 BrazilState & Municipal Taxes

Brazil has one of the world's most complex tax systems. States levy ICMS at 7%–18% varying by state. Municipalities levy ISS (services tax) at 2%–5% and IPTU (urban property tax). A sweeping tax reform (EC 132/2023) is gradually replacing ICMS/ISS with unified IBS and CBS taxes through 2033. States impose ITCMD (inheritance/gift tax) up to 8%.
